This is not in ftfont_close, this is in ftcrfont_close.
If you can tell why FT_List_Find crashes, in terms of Emacs variables
and data structures, maybe we can figure out what is going on here.
But in any case, I think we should put the same workaround in
ftcrfont_close as we did in ftfont_close, because the former calls the
latter, and we then risk the situation where we only half-close the
font when ftcrfont_close is called from GC.
